This message indicates that a SIRFIELD 'subcmd' command was issued with the CENTSPAN or SPANSIZE clause, and the ERROR or ALTERNATES formats, or both, have been set for the field. Since records have been added to the file, allowing a different CENTSPAN or SPANSIZE could cause previous values matched by one format to now be matched by a different format, which might change the data, for example when you reorganize the file.

The command is rejected.
